Puerto Rico bridge safety

Condition ratings, load ratings, and Poor-condition data for every public highway bridge in Puerto Rico, based on the FHWA National Bridge Inventory.

Total Bridges

2,387

Public highway bridges in Puerto Rico

Good Condition

14.1%

336 bridges rated 7-9

-35.9pp vs 50% benchmark

Poor Condition

12.0%

286 bridges whose lowest applicable component is rated 0-4

5.0pp vs national avg 7.0%

Poor condition is an inspection-record category, not a closure or unsafe-to-cross designation. Consult the bridge owner for current status.
